Cordier

Cordier operates across Bordeaux's diverse terroirs, producing wines that span the region's classic expressions. Château Lauretan Bordeaux Blanc blends Sauvignon Blanc and Sémillon into a crisp white, while Château Haut Joubert Premières Côtes de Blaye draws on Merlot, Cabernet Franc, and Cabernet Sauvignon for a structured red. The portfolio extends beyond Bordeaux proper to Laudun Côtes-du-Rhône-Villages, where Syrah and Grenache create a southern Rhône expression. Wine Enthusiast and Wine Spectator have assessed the range, reflecting the house's presence across France's major wine regions.
